How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• holding that because appeal of underlying order had been resolved “all issues regarding the propriety of a supersedeas bond [were] moot.”
  • holding that because appeal of underlying order had been resolved “all issues regarding the propriety of a supersedeas bond [were] moot”
  • dismissing as moot an appeal from a supersedeas bond when the main appeal had been decided
